Description
The PNY NVIDIA T1000 Professional Graphics Card (VCNT1000-PB) features 4GB of GDDR6 memory and a 128-bit memory interface, delivering 160 GB/s of memory bandwidth. Powered by the NVIDIA Turing architecture, it offers significant performance improvements. This card supports a maximum resolution of 7680 x 4320 pixels and has DirectX version 12.0 and OpenGL version 4.5. It connects via PCI Express 3.0 x16 and includes four mini DisplayPort 1.4 outputs, supporting up to four 5K displays or two 8K displays per card. The low-profile, single-slot form factor with an active fansink makes it suitable for compact workstations. With a maximum power consumption of 50W, it is an energy-efficient solution for demanding professional workflows in industries such as manufacturing, media & entertainment, AEC, and financial services. It is compatible with professional software applications and industry standards, providing enhanced productivity and stunning visuals.
